From: Sakari Ailus Date: Wed, 6 Dec 2023 11:35:33 +0000 (+0200) Subject: media: saa6752hs: Don't set format in sub-device state X-Git-Url: http://git.maquefel.me/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=c692696fc51c5acee555b94d391d328510b557c8;p=linux.git media: saa6752hs: Don't set format in sub-device state For the purpose of setting old non-pad based sub-device try format as a basis for VIDIOC_TRY_FMT implementation, there is no need to set the format in the sub-device state. Drop the assignment to the state, which would result in a NULL pointer dereference.
